I go to ED Howard Mazda in sarasota,there's a guy name Ranee and he's the only rx7 mechanic,and he placed first in national competion,plus there's about 25 third gen and some of the older ones there.I got my new engine installed there and tranny,turbos,ect.... Plus every third gen owner i talk to that goes there is nothing but positive about the guy,Plus i have to give the mechanic props,cause i had a electrical problems and he went through everything,and trust me there's alot of wires,and he fixed it,never had any problems since.

Tampa
Jeff Gladdish is the owner of Maztech @ 4810 N. Clark in Tampa (just off of Osbourne close to Ray Jat Stadium) 813-874-0937.
He has taken care of me for 5 years or 65,000 miles.
Just rebuilt @ 112k
He is a true rotorhead and has a top notch staff! They all drive Rotors!
Tell him Foz recommended him!
He not only knows his stuff, but will let you know if there is an inexpensive way to fix it.
For example, my driverside door lock jammed and I couldn't use it. I was ready to buy a new one, and he fixed my old one for $25.
